Duty to obtain information relating to customers
73.
(1)
Telecommunications service providers must ensure that the
prescribed information is obtained from all customers.
(2)
The information referred to in subsection (1) must be sufficient to
determine which telephone number or other identification has been issued to a specific
customer in order to make it possible to intercept the telecommunications of that
customer.
Functions of Authority relating to interception
74.
(1)
Any duty imposed by this part or any regulation made in terms
of this Part may be enforced as if such duty were a licence condition imposed under this
Act.
(2)
The Authority may adjudicate any dispute that may arise between a
telecommunications service provider and an interception centre, if such a dispute relates
to any duty imposed by this Part or a regulation made in terms of any provision of this
Part.
